“Red line that cannot be crossed”
“The team will be very well prepared for the talks in Vienna. We have considered this proposal and are preparing a wide-ranging and constructive answer”, Jeremić told B92.The president’s advisor also said Belgrade “will not be able to compromise” over its fundamental objection to Ahtisaari’s plan, namely, a lack of clear and unequivocal mention of Serbia’s territorial integrity over Kosovo.
“In any case, that is the red line we cannot cross and there is no plan B that lies on the other side of that line”, Jeremić says, adding that Serbia’s territorial sovereignty is the key point of the negotiating platform that will not be abandoned. The UN special envoy Martti Ahtisaari has yesterday decided to postpone the start of Vienna talks for February 21.
